Charting the the Sultanate of Oman

The Sultanate of Oman, positioned in the southeastern corner of the Arabian Peninsula, boasts a varied landscape. A map of this captivating country reveals a coastline that stretches along the bustling Gulf of Oman and the peaceful Arabian Sea. Inland, mountains tower, creating rugged terrain punctuated by fertile oases. The important location of Oman, connecting the continents of Asia and Africa, has shaped its profound history and cultural heritage.

Salalah in the Sultanate of Oman

Nestled on the southern coast of the Sultanate more info of Oman, Salalah is a captivating oasis renowned for its breathtaking landscapes and diverse culture. Throughout the khareef season, from June to September, the region experiences an influx of refreshing monsoon winds, transforming Salalah into a lush paradise. Visitors can admire the cascading waterfalls, verdant valleys, and abundant flora that paint the landscape in vibrant hues.

Economy

The Sultanate of Oman boasts a diverse economy grounded in both historical sectors and modern industries. Oil and gas remain primary contributors, propelling substantial government revenue. However, the Omani government diligently seeks to diversify its economic structure through initiatives in sectors such as tourism, manufacturing, and fisheries. The country's strategic location along major shipping routes and stable political climate encourage a favorable business environment, drawing both domestic and foreign funding. Oman's commitment to green development is clear in its programs aimed at preserving natural resources while encouraging economic expansion.
